This study examines the effect of regulatory policy on efficiency under prudential framework among banks listed in the Iranian Securities and Exchange Organization over the period 2003 to 2015. Arellano-Bond estimation method has been patronized to investigate the effect of regulatory policies on efficiency. IIn recent years, policymakers have generally relied on regulatory policies to address financial stability concerns. However, our understanding of these policies and their efficacy in curbing housing prices is limited. Background The unregulated availability and irrational use of tuberculosis (TB) medicines is a major issue of public health concern globally. Governments of many low- and middle-income countries (LMICs) have committed to regulating the quality and availability of TB medicines, but with variable success.
